
Police in the Ashanti Region have arrested three young men believed
to have taken part in an alleged gang rape of a teenage girl, a video of
which has gone viral on social media.
The police were alerted to the assault after the video
began circulating on social media with the young men taking turns to
rape the teenager. A source says about 7 men forcibly had sex with the
girl but only 4 were seen in the video. Three of the men whose faces
showed in the video have been identified and arrested.

The Domestic Violence and Victim Support Unit (DOVVSU) of the Ashanti
Regional Police Command has invited the teenage victim to assist in
investigations. The victim was reportedly also taken to the Komfo Anokye
Teaching Hospital for medical examination. The incident occurred at
Bantama in Kumasi.

The Police say they are on a manhunt to arrest other members of the gang, while investigation into the incident continues.
